Tax Accountant

 

Reports to: Partner or Tax Senior Manager

 

Summary:

 

Provides tax preparation and planning services for client engagements.

 

Duties:

 

•      Professionally prepares individual, corporate, partnership and fiduciary income tax returns

•      Manages correspondence and gathers appropriate evidence to respond to notices from taxing authorities

•      Prepares tax projections for individual and business clients

•      Financial statement preparation to support entity income tax returns

•      Other duties as assigned
